Dan Nolte of Rochester Earns 1st Place At Flower City Opener

Dan Nolte of Rochester Earns 1st Place At Flower City Opener

From University of Rochester Athletics

Dan Nolte kicked off his junior year with a victory at the Flower City Opener 6k cross country race for the University of Rochester on Saturday afternoon at Genesee Valley Park.
 
Nolte completed the course in 19:47.9, edging out Alex Beals from SUNY Geneseo by less than one second for the individual title.  Geneseo would get the last laugh on the team scoreboard though, earning the win with 32 points to 2nd place Rochester's 35.  RIT ended 3rd with 68 points and Nazareth was 4th with 115.
 
Senior Jeremy Hassett was the second UR finisher across the finish line, placing 4th overall in 20:11.7 while junior Eric Franklin was 5th, 2.2 seconds behind Hassett.
 
Junior Matt Prohaska finished in 13th place overall in 20:50.7, scoring as the fourth UR finisher and Mintesinot Kassu's 19th place result was the fifth UR runner, crossing the stripe in 21:00.2.
 
Displacers for Rochester were freshman Forrest Hangen (21st, 21:01.5) and freshman Andrew Gutierrez (25th, 21:25.7).
 
Other finishers for Rochester included freshman Christopher Dalke in 34th, sophomore Nate Conroy in 35th, junior Chris Cook in 37th and freshman Jeremy Hartse in 41st.
